          No i think youre giving the husband too much neatness there. He is not just protecting pride he is also lazy in the moral sense, happy to let the system do the dirty work. That is why the book hurts. The harm does not need a villain with a plan, just people who prefer the furniture left where it is

                  Yeah i get that. The shifting narrators keep everybody squinting at her like they own the meaning and that gets ugly fast. Surreal part is one thing but the family control stuff is worse, because it feels ordinary. People always want to call it illness or drama or art when maybe it’s just coercion with a nicer label and a hot meal attached
